Description :
A game on an undirected graph is played by two players, Mouse and Cat, who alternate turns.
The graph is given as follows: graph[a]
is a list of all nodes b
ab
is an edge of the graph.
Mouse starts at node 1 and goes first, Cat starts at node 2 and goes second, and there is a Hole at node 0.
During each player's turn, they must travel along one edge of the graph that meets where they are. For example, if the Mouse is at node 1
, it must travel to any node in graph[1]
Additionally, it is not allowed for the Cat to travel to the Hole (node 0.)
Then, the game can end in 3 ways:
- If ever the Cat occupies the same node as the Mouse, the Cat wins.
- If ever the Mouse reaches the Hole, the Mouse wins.
- If ever a position is repeated (ie. the players are in the same position as a previous turn, and it is the same player's turn to move), the game is a draw.
